Size: a a a

var chat = new Chat();

2021 September 02

EG

Egor Gusarenko in var chat = new Chat();
До сих пор не знаю как такое поведение определяется, но скорее всего синглтон на старте просто получает какой-то инстанс скоупда и "питается" от него игнорируя другие
источник

IV

Ihor Volokhovych in var chat = new Chat();
Можно, но у меня в рантайме коллекция хранится
источник

Ɖ

Ɖrēw in var chat = new Chat();
На каждый топик свой консьюмер имхо. Иначе получится огромная свалка из свитч кейсов
источник

🌸

🌸Durdona🌸 in var chat = new Chat();
/readonlyandremove@Gopnegbot
источник

UD

Uno Dark in var chat = new Chat();
И так, я провел свое расследование: если брать один  консюмер на 5 топиков то получается примерно 15 потоков; если брать на каждый топик по консюмеру то есть 5 то получается где-то 50 потоков
источник

UD

Uno Dark in var chat = new Chat();
На проде где-то 100 топиков
источник

AS

Andrii Shcherbyna in var chat = new Chat();
А откуда такое количество потоков?
источник

UD

Uno Dark in var chat = new Chat();
Task manager -> details
источник

AS

Andrii Shcherbyna in var chat = new Chat();
Такие вещи не привязывают к потокам одной машины. Важна нагрузка на MQ; как у тебя репликация и разделение на partitions настроены; какие функциональные и не функциональные требования; важен ли порядок процессинга сообщений и т.д.
источник

AS

Andrii Shcherbyna in var chat = new Chat();
Я это давно делал (не всё помню), но там же ещё есть группы консьюмеров
источник

AS

Andrii Shcherbyna in var chat = new Chat();
В общем по кафке советую вот этот видос посмотреть. Там про разделение на partitions и про группы consumers понятно описано
https://www.youtube.com/watch?v=-AZOi3kP9Js&list=LL&index=9&ab_channel=%D0%92%D0%BB%D0%B0%D0%B4%D0%B8%D0%BC%D0%B8%D1%80%D0%91%D0%BE%D0%B3%D0%B4%D0%B0%D0%BD%D0%BE%D0%B2%D1%81%D0%BA%D0%B8%D0%B9
источник

UD

Uno Dark in var chat = new Chat();
Thank you so much!
источник

Ɖ

Ɖrēw in var chat = new Chat();
Может какая то зависимость ее тянет?
источник

Ɖ

Ɖrēw in var chat = new Chat();
PowerBot.Web - что там?
источник

Ɖ

Ɖrēw in var chat = new Chat();
Там есть какой то имейлж для аспнеткора, тебе нужно использовать его
источник

Ɖ

Ɖrēw in var chat = new Chat();
Создай в райдере или в студии проект с поддержкой докера
источник

Ɖ

Ɖrēw in var chat = new Chat();
Посмотри что там в докерфайле
источник

Ɖ

Ɖrēw in var chat = new Chat();
Да, его пробуй
источник

Ɖ

Ɖrēw in var chat = new Chat();
Покажи что в той консольке
источник

Ɖ

Ɖrēw in var chat = new Chat();
Которую запускаешь
источник